I have the iPod Classic the one that they discontinued it's 160 GB. I love it because I can store all the music that I want, all the movies that I want and even use it as a back up drive. On the other hand the iPod touch has a much better visual interface and it's more attractive to the eye. With all the new apps coming out for the iPhone and iTouch it's becoming the trend to follow.
When I bought my iPod I paid the same price that a 32 GB iTouch costs.
In conclusion I wouldn't trade my Classic for a Touch just yet, unless they come out with a 160 GB iPod touch. Hope it helps.

Well 8GB is alot less than 80GB but if the change in memory doesn't bother you I would suggest the iPOd Touch. Just recently I switched in my iPod Classic 30GB for the iPod Touch 2nd Gen and I'm loving it. It has wifi and built in speakers so you don't have to always have earphones in. Plus touching it is addictive! It has notes where you can write memos to yourself and you can password protect it. If you don't want people snooping through you videos or photos or internet activity you name it! The Passcode protection is amazing. I personally couldn't be happier. The only thing I miss is the memory. With the Classic I felt like i could put the whole world on my iPOd now I'm always wondering, Will it be enough for me?
